replacing factory head unit?

has any one out there ever replace the head unit on a 2004 tl with the factory nav. i have seen pics on other websites that it has been done but i find that the nav no longer works when you unplug the headunit. any help would be great.

Good luck. No aftermarket company makes a dash kit for our car to change out the head unit and still have all of the surrounding area look stock. I have looked into this and at this point I don't think it's possible to do and also make it look good.

im replacing the factory unit with an alpine iva-d310 flip out dvd screen. ive already done a complete audio upgrade and have made the dash piece to trim out the radio with a sunk in plexi window with the acura logo etched into it and backlite with blue leds. i guess im going to just relocate the factory radio to somewhere else in the car. maybe the front pass footwell or in the trunk. i will have to extend about 45 wires to make this happen. i will have pics next week when i finish it.
